Extensive quality control produces lot-to-lot consistency that instills confidence in results and ensures reproducibility. Applications: Binding Activity

Measured by its binding ability in a functional ELISA. In a Human IgG Fc Antibody (Catalog # G-102-C) coated plate, Recombinant Human LRP-1 Cluster IV Fc Chimera binds Recombinant Human LRPAP (Catalog # 4296-LR ) with an ED50 of 0.25-1.25 ng/mL.

Specifications

Formulation Lyophilized from a 0.2 μm filtered solution in PBS with Trehalose.
Gene ID (Entrez) 4035
Molecular Weight (g/mol) 76.7 kDa
Name LRP-1 Cluster IV Fc Chimera
Quantity 50μg
Source Chinese Hamster Ovary cell line,CHO-derived human LRP-1 Cluster IV protein, (N-terminus) Human LRP1-C4 (Ser3332-Asp3779) Accession &Num; Q07954 IEGRMD Human IgG1 (Pro100-Lys330) (C-terminus)
Storage Requirements Use a manual defrost freezer and av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les. 12 months from date of receipt, -20 to -70° C as supplied. 1 month, 2 to 8° C under sterile conditions after reconstitution. 3 months, -20 to -70° C under sterile conditions after reconstitution.
Structural Form Disulfide-linked homodimer
Conjugate Unconjugated
Recombinant Recombinant
Purity or Quality Grade >90%, by SDS-PAGE visualized with Silver Staining and quantitative densitometry by Coomassie™ Blue Staining.
